OverviewThese accomplished, gothic-infused stories impress in terms of their range and unexpected twists - this is an exceptional debut collection that includes the title novella, 'The Gorgon Flower'. A young woman is haunted by the disappearance of her grandmother, a brilliant mathematician whose research uncovered the basis for parallel universes. A botanist travels across the seas in search of an elusive, deadly flower that was also his late father's obsession. A talented painter produces his best work - unsettling masterpieces with strange, fantastical elements - years after he was last seen in person. In this gothic-inspired collection of stories, John Richards pushes the limits of what short fiction can be. With settings that range from rural France to medieval Italy and nineteenth-century Borneo, The Gorgon Flower is an impressively crafted, engrossing debut by a bold new writer. The Gorgon Flower is a curious, clever, highly enjoyable read.' - Amanda O'Callaghan Author InformationJohn Richards was educated in the UK and lived in London and Singapore before settling in Brisbane. He was shortlisted for the Elizabeth Jolley Short Story Award in 2021 and the Glendower Award for an Emerging Queensland Writer in August 2022. The Gorgon Flower is his first published work of fiction. Tab Content 6Author Website:Countries AvailableAll regions |
